  2. Overview of Basic Competencies in Front Office Hospitality
    There are seven core competencies students must achieve related to front office operations:
    • Handling Incoming Telephone Reception:
      Ability to answer and manage incoming phone calls professionally.
    • Making Telephone Calls:
      Skill in placing calls appropriately and managing outgoing communication.
    • Understanding and Managing Messages:
      Handling messages effectively (referred to as "Pandu or Henley messages").
    • Individual Reservation Handling:
      Managing room reservations made by individual guests.
    • Group Reservation Handling:
      Managing reservations for groups or bus bookings.
    • Reservation Updates:
      Ability to modify or update existing reservations.
    • Reservation Cancellations:
      Handling cancellations professionally and efficiently.

  5. Project Assignments
    Students are given three main projects to apply their learning practically:
    • Project 1: Create a short video about handling messages ("Henley messages") and upload it on social media platforms like YouTube, Instagram, or TikTok. Students are free to use any video editing application they prefer.
    • Project 2: Prepare a slide presentation explaining the flow of booking rooms through Online Travel Agents (OTAs) such as Pegipegi, Misteraladin, or Tiket.com. Students can use any slide creation software.
    • Project 3: Produce a video demonstrating how to handle individual room reservations. This video should be uploaded to YouTube, and the link submitted via a Google Form shared by the teacher.
